public RasterImage GetOverlayImage(int index,RasterGetSetOverlayImageMode mode)
Public Function GetOverlayImage( _ByVal index As Integer, _ByVal mode As RasterGetSetOverlayImageMode _) As RasterImage
- (nullable LTRasterImage *)getOverlayForImageAtIndex:(NSInteger)indexmode:(LTRasterGetSetOverlayImageMode)modeerror:(NSError **)error
public:RasterImage^ GetOverlayImage(int index,RasterGetSetOverlayImageMode mode)
index
The index of the overlay being retrieved. This index is zero-based and should be less or equal than MaxOverlays.
mode
Determines how to retreive the image, possible values are:
| Mode | Description |
|---|---|
| RasterGetSetOverlayImageMode.Copy | A copy of the overlay image is retrieved from the overlay list. |
| RasterGetSetOverlayImageMode.NoCopy | The actual overlay image is retrieved. No copy is made. You should be careful when modifying the returned overlay image because you can modify/invalidate the entry in the overlay bitmap list. |
| RasterGetSetOverlayImageMode.Move | The actual overlay image is retrieved. The image is also removed from the overlay list. This is recommended over RasterGetSetOverlayImageMode.NoCopy. |
A RasterImage object that represents the overlay image of the specified index.
This method is available in the (Document/Medical only) Toolkits.
This method can be used to get a copy of the overlay image (RasterGetSetOverlayImageMode.Copy) or to get the image without making a copy (RasterGetSetOverlayImageMode.NoCopy or RasterGetSetOverlayImageMode.Move).
The quickest way to get the overlay image is to avoid making a copy. For more information on using RasterGetSetOverlayImageMode.NoCopy, refer to the "Remarks" section of SetOverlayImage.
For more information, refer to Overlay Overview.
using Leadtools;using Leadtools.Codecs;using Leadtools.ImageProcessing;using Leadtools.ImageProcessing.Core;using Leadtools.ImageProcessing.Color;using Leadtools.Dicom;using Leadtools.Drawing;using Leadtools.Controls;using Leadtools.Svg;public void GetOverlayImageExample(){RasterCodecs codecs = new RasterCodecs();// load an image and set an overlayRasterImage image = codecs.Load(Path.Combine(LEAD_VARS.ImagesDir, "DICOM","image2.dcm"), 0, CodecsLoadByteOrder.BgrOrGray, 1, 1);RasterImage imageOverlay1 = codecs.Load(Path.Combine(LEAD_VARS.ImagesDir, "ulay1.bmp"), 1, CodecsLoadByteOrder.Rgb, 1, 1);RasterImage imageOverlay2 = codecs.Load(Path.Combine(LEAD_VARS.ImagesDir, "ulay1.bmp"), 1, CodecsLoadByteOrder.Rgb, 1, 1);image.SetOverlayImage(0, imageOverlay1, RasterGetSetOverlayImageMode.Copy);image.SetOverlayImage(1, imageOverlay2, RasterGetSetOverlayImageMode.Copy);// update the attributes of one of the overlaysRasterOverlayAttributes attributes = image.GetOverlayAttributes(0,RasterGetSetOverlayAttributesFlags.Color |RasterGetSetOverlayAttributesFlags.Flags |RasterGetSetOverlayAttributesFlags.Origin |RasterGetSetOverlayAttributesFlags.BitIndex);attributes.Color = new RasterColor(255, 255, 255);attributes.AutoPaint = true;attributes.AutoProcess = true;attributes.Origin = new LeadPoint(5, 5);attributes.BitPosition = image.BitsPerPixel - 1;image.UpdateOverlayAttributes(0,attributes,RasterGetSetOverlayAttributesFlags.Color |RasterGetSetOverlayAttributesFlags.Flags |RasterGetSetOverlayAttributesFlags.Origin |RasterGetSetOverlayAttributesFlags.BitIndex);int count = image.OverlayCount;for (int i = 0; i < count; i++){using (RasterImage overlayTest = image.GetOverlayImage(i, RasterGetSetOverlayImageMode.NoCopy)){string fileName = string.Format(Path.Combine(LEAD_VARS.ImagesDir, "overlay{0}_copy.bmp"), i);codecs.Save(overlayTest, fileName, RasterImageFormat.Bmp, 1);}}image.Dispose();imageOverlay1.Dispose();imageOverlay2.Dispose();codecs.Dispose();}static class LEAD_VARS{public const string ImagesDir = @"C:\LEADTOOLS21\Resources\Images";}
